Phoebe Wright came narrowly close to a world championship berth in the women’s 800 meters, and Evander Wells bowed out in the semifinal round of the men’s 200 Sunday, as the USA Outdoor Track & Field Championships came to a close in Eugene, Ore.
A former Lady Vol NCAA indoor and outdoor champion in the 800, Wright made a push to make the U.S. squad for the upcoming IAAF World Championships, but she came up short by a slim margin in her bid for a top-three outcome.  Just 4/100ths of a second separated her from accomplishing her goal, as she placed fourth in 1:59.25, just behind the third-place effort of 1:59.21 from Alice Schmidt.
Wells, an ex-Vol who was fourth at last year’s NCAA Outdoor meet in the 200, ran in the USA semifinals on Sunday.  His 20.63 output left him third in heat two and 12th overall.
